Transaction 74139c980485c71412a776795fa715641491708a73e853300ae4bf7d847084ec

2 Input
2 Outputs
  • 74139c980485c71412a776795fa715641491708a73e853300ae4bf7d847084ec:0
  • value  182760
    address  1JL1V498eVUytMJLbjDVa482iE6c8M83kZ
  • 74139c980485c71412a776795fa715641491708a73e853300ae4bf7d847084ec:1
  • value  1056280
    address  16xCBJg7EX1VVP7oTn5WGg8nQodj6vKYkA